The updates to the various DB tables as a result of DAG file parsing and collection are scattered throughout the code base.

This change gathers them all in to one place to make it easier to a) find, and b) see what is changed.

The current situation is the result of organic code growth, but it is now almost impossible to find all the things we update as they are not organized, and were scatterd across at least DagBag, DagProcessor.

As part of Airflow 3 DAG definition files will have to use the Task SDK for
all their classes, and anything involving running user code will need to be
de-coupled from the database in the user-code process.
This change moves all of the "serialization" change up to the
DagFileProcessorManager, using the new function introduced in apache#44898 and the
"subprocess" machinery introduced in apache#44874.
**Important Note**: this change does not remove the ability for dag processes
to access the DB for Variables etc. That will come in a future change.
Some key parts of this change:
- It builds upon the WatchedSubprocess from the TaskSDK. Right now this puts a
nasty/unwanted depenednecy between the Dag Parsing code upon the TaskSDK.
This will be addressed before release (we have talked about introducing a
new "apache-airflow-base-executor" dist where this subprocess+supervisor
could live, as the "execution_time" folder in the Task SDK is more a feature
of the executor, not of the TaskSDK itself)
- A number of classes that we need to send between processes have been
converted to Pydantic for ease of serialization.
- In order to not have to serialize everything in the subprocess and deserialize everything
in the parent Manager process, we have created a `LazyDeserializedDAG` class
that provides lazy access to much of the properties needed to create update
the DAG related DB objects, without needing to fully deserialize the entire
DAG structure.
- Classes switched to attrs based for less boilerplate in constructors.
- Internal timers convert to `time.monotonic` where possible, and `time.time`
where not, we only need second diff between two points, not datetime objects
- With the earlier removal of "sync mode" for SQLite in apache#44839 the need for
separate TERMIANTE and END messages over the control socket can go
